What Are Spider and Varicose Veins?

Spider veins are small, superficial veins that may appear red, blue, or purple on the skin. Varicose veins are larger, more prominent veins that can become visible over time. Understanding Venous Insufficiency

Some individuals may have underlying venous insufficiency, which occurs when larger veins do not move blood upward as efficiently. What is Sclerotherapy?

Sclerotherapy uses FDA‑approved Asclera® to treat small veins. During the procedure, we inject a targeted solution into the selected veins. Over the following weeks, the treated veins gradually fade in appearance. Each session lasts about 15–45 minutes, and most people find the experience comfortable and easy to tolerate.

What Happens After My Sclerotherapy Treatments?

After your session, we apply compression stockings to support the healing process. We encourage you to walk for 20–30 minutes to promote circulation. Most people return to normal activities right away. We also review sun‑exposure guidelines and aftercare instructions to help you achieve the best cosmetic outcome.

Other Treatment Options

Sclerotherapy works well for spider veins and small varicose veins. For very small veins, we may recommend transdermal laser treatment. For larger veins or confirmed venous insufficiency, options such as vein ablation or micro‑phlebectomy may be appropriate.
